George Herbert provided the series Something Understood with its title and so is, in a sense, the programme’s literary patron. Mark Tully presents a celebration of the seventeenth century metaphysical poet’s life and work in conversation with his latest biographer John Drury, and discusses the relevance Herbert can still have for us today.

There are readings of Herbert’s work and the music his verse has inspired. The featured authors and composers include Vikram Seth, T S Eliot, Alec Roth, Sandy Denny and Vaughan Williams.

The readers are Jane Whittenshaw, David Westhead and Francis Cadder.
